Public bug reported:

when i start nautilus from terminal with 
nautilus 
i can connect to any ftp server etc 
but when i start nautilus from terminal with
sudo nautilus
and try to use the connect to Server option the connect button is always greyed 
out
When i type strg+L and give the server
ftp://someserveraddress 
and press enter nautilus crashes with the following error message
oops! something went wrong.
Unable to find the requested file. Please chekc the spelling and try again.
I am using ubuntu 18.04 with GNOME nautilus 3.26.4
